Parity-Violating Electron Scattering From 4he And The Strange Electric Form Factor Of The Nucleon, K. A. Aniol, Edgar E. Kooijman

We have measured the parity-violating electroweak asymmetry in the elastic scattering of polarized electrons from 4He at an average scattering angle ⟨θlab⟩=5.7° and a four-momentum transfer Q2=0.091 GeV2. From these data, for the first time, the strange electric form factor of the nucleon GEs can be isolated. The measured asymmetry of APV=(6.72±0.84(stat)±0.21(syst))×10-6 yields a value of GEs=-0.038±0.042(stat)±0.010(syst), consistent with zero.
